>> Is there a way to adjust MSS just like in cisco's "ip tcp adjust-mss"?
>> I want to play only with MSS not with MTU.
>> So far the only solution that I found is pf+scrub, but I wander if it 
>> is possible to do it without
>> firewall.
>
> depends on how you want to do it? Are you asking becuase you are
> running ppp or mpd? Or do you want to change it globally for
> everything of a machine?
>
I'm experimenting with gre tunnels - the problem comes from async routes.
 From gre0 I receive traffic, but replies are sent over Ethernet card.
So I can't make mtu on if0 the same as the mtu on gre0.
